Krasonis: “A very difficult weekend with excellent results”

Thomas Krasonis is completely satisfied with the results in the four races on Italian soil. “It was a very difficult weekend, on a track of special characteristics. The two races on Sunday were demanding, but overall the result of the second race weekend of the season is absolutely positive” said Thomas Krasonis.

He added: “In the OPEN race I chose to follow to the letter the rule set out in the restart procedure after yellow flags all over the track. Some other drivers were absolutely marginal in the restart procedure, which is why the stewards considered at length the possibility of imposing jump start penalties. We may have been off the podium this time, but fourth place gave us valuable points, as we are at the top of the standings after two races on one of the most difficult tracks of the season. In the PRO I chose to protect my car’s engine when I realised the temperature was marginally higher, due to being in the impure air of those ahead of me for some time. In racing you have to drive with brains and caution. Sometimes it is better to limit yourself to a lower position in the classification, ensuring that you don’t give up and that you get the points needed to achieve the final goal. This podium kept us in the top three of the standings, and that’s the most important thing.”

He concluded: “Next up is the race at Brands Hatch, a track that is one of my favourites. We will prepare properly and give it our all to get the results that will keep us within our targets this year.
